How they compare
Eastern Europe currently reports 76,311 kt against 16,800 kt in Indonesia, a difference of 59,511 kt.
That makes Eastern Europe's figure about 4.5 times Indonesia's.
Across all 63 years both countries report, Eastern Europe has been ahead every year.
Eastern Europe ranks 15th and Indonesia ranks 14th of 32 groups.
Eastern Europe has averaged higher in every one of the 7 decades both report.
Head to head by decade
| Decade | Eastern Europe | Indonesia |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 21,021 kt | 508.67 kt | 20,512 kt | Eastern Europe |
| 1970s | 36,093 kt | 849 kt | 35,244 kt | Eastern Europe |
| 1980s | 54,515 kt | 1,449 kt | 53,066 kt | Eastern Europe |
| 1990s | 45,684 kt | 1,772 kt | 43,912 kt | Eastern Europe |
| 2000s | 44,948 kt | 4,940 kt | 40,008 kt | Eastern Europe |
| 2010s | 54,323 kt | 8,536 kt | 45,787 kt | Eastern Europe |
| 2020s | 71,836 kt | 15,150 kt | 56,686 kt | Eastern Europe |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
